The Nevada Air National Guard is the aerial militia of the State of Nevada, United States of America. Along with the Nevada Army National Guard, it is an element of the Nevada National Guard. The units of the Nevada Air National Guard are not in the normal United States Air Force chain of command.
Our Mission. The Nevada Army and Air National Guard maintains a dual federal and state mission. The federal mission supports the nation with trained and ready units for deployment overseas, domestic contingencies, and -- if ever required -- homeland defense.
The Nevada Air National Guard’s history dates back nearly 75 years, predominantly in northern Nevada, and is best explained through its mission sets: fighter (1948-1961), piloted reconnaissance (1961-1995) and its modern era with tactical airlift and unmanned reconnaissance (1996-present).
The Nevada Air National Guard has two main bases across the state located in Indian Springs and Reno. They perform five unique missions training and preparing the citizen-airman to respond to the Governor of Nevada for state emergencies or the call of the President in times of crisis.
